What Are CNC Machines?

What Are CNC Machines?

CNC machines, or Computer Numerical Control machines, are automated tools used in the production sector to precisely regulate machining procedures with computer software, making them essential tools in modern-day assembly line.

These devices have changed the way products are produced, enabling high degrees of accuracy and effectiveness that were previously unattainable. The historic advancement of CNC equipments go back to the mid-20th century when they were first introduced for armed forces applications and later on taken on by private markets. Today, CNC makers play a important duty in industries such as vehicle, aerospace, electronic devices, and medical tools.

Examples of CNC tools include CNC milling devices, turrets, routers, grinders, and plasma cutters. Each sort of CNC device is specialized for particular applications, providing adaptability and precision in different manufacturing processes.

Exactly How Do CNC Machines Work?

CNC devices function by using computer software to manage the activity of devices and machinery, enabling precision manufacturing procedures such as milling, directing, and cutting.

This innovation allows for elaborate layouts and highly accurate outputs because of the organized nature of procedures carried out by CNC equipments. The computerized control not only improves effectiveness but also decreases human error in the manufacturing process.

For example, in CNC milling makers, the set instructions dictate the path and deepness of the reducing tool, leading to consistent and repeatable production runs. In a similar way, CNC routers are extensively utilized in woodworking and metalworking industries for jobs like inscription, cutting, and shaping different materials with extraordinary information and speed.

CNC Plasma Cutters

CNC Plasma Cutters CNC plasma cutters are specialized machines made use of for puncturing electrically conductive products with high accuracy and speed, making them valuable possessions in metal manufacture sectors.

These cutters function by guiding a high-speed jet of ionized gas in the direction of the steel surface area, while an electric arc is created that melts the metal. The precision of the cutting is managed by computer mathematical control (CNC) innovation, which guarantees complex designs are accurately reproduced.

Among the key advantages of CNC plasma cutters is their ability to puncture different thicknesses of steel, varying from thin sheets to thick plates, with minimal heat-affected areas. This causes clean cuts, lowering the need for additional handling and reducing material waste.

There are different types of CNC plasma cutters offered, including portable, robot, and portable systems, each accommodating specific commercial needs. Portable cutters are frequently utilized for onsite repair work and maintenance, while robotic systems are preferred for massive production in industries such as automotive, aerospace, and construction.

CNC Waterjet Cutters

CNC waterjet cutters utilize high-pressure streams of water mixed with abrasive materials to puncture different materials, using a cold-cutting procedure that reduces product contortion and heat-affected areas.

This technology is specifically beneficial for reducing fragile or heat-sensitive products like foam, rubber, and plastics, where conventional cutting approaches could result in distortion or thermal damages. By exactly controlling the waterjet's pressure and speed, these equipments supply exact cuts with smooth edges, reducing the need for added finishing processes.

The versatility of waterjet reducing devices enables them to be used throughout several industries, including aerospace, automotive, and design.
